How is Jet Skiing on the Salton Sea, CA?

i read on several sites that the Salton Sea allows jet skiing. I live in NJ and i have been to San Diego and i loved it there. I was thinking about moving and since i jetski here in jersey I would like to find a great place to jetski near San Diego. I was wondering if anyone has been there to jetski? how is the water, flat or choppy? is it cold? is it clean? Are there available slips at docks and are there launching ramps?

While jet skiing is allowed at Salton Sea and the lake is fairly huge, I sure wouldn’t want to go there. The water is extremely corrosive due to the salt content and chemical run-offs from the nearby farms. Salton Sea is renowned for the massive fish die offs where the shores are literally covered in thousands of dead and dying fish. There is some chop when the wind blows, temp is around 60 degrees in winter and mid 70 degrees in summer. Public launch ramps are available. As for being clean, let’s just say I felt like getting a tetnus shot after I went there.
The only fresh water jet skiing available in San Diego County is at El Capitan reservoir ( small and boring ), which is located in Lakeside. Other fresh water areas that you can take your pwc is Lake Elsinore ( so-so ) or Lake Perris ( fairly decent for fresh water ) in Riverside County, which is about an hour north of San Diego, or Big Bear Lake in San Bernadino county, which is 2.5 hrs out of S.D. If your willing to drive out to Salton, the Colorado river isn’t that much further, along with Lake Havasu. All the above places are nicer, but can get very crowded.

Your best bet, just ride out in either Sand Diego Bay or Mission Bay or along the coastline ( watch out for seaweed!) Public ramps at both places, beautiful scenery, and a mix of riding action available from glassy surfaces to wave jumping. Water temp is from the upper 50’s in winter to mid 70’s in summer. That’s were I do the vast majority of my riding.

Action Park was a waterpark/motor themed park open from 1978 to 1996 in Vernon Township, New Jersey, on the property of the former Vernon Valley / Great Gorge ski area, today Mountain Creek. It featured three separate attraction areas: an alpine slide; Motorworld, where patrons could operate motorized vehicles on land and water; and Waterworld, with many water-based attractions such as waterslides…
